MAIN DISHES- PORK:
Smoked Pork Chops with
Maple Baked Apples
|
Smoked
Pork Chops with Maple Baked Apples |
|
|
|
No applesauce for
these pork chops- just apples and a great, sweet flavor!
|
|
4
|
|
1"
thick smoked pork chops |
|
|
1
large |
|
Rome
apple, diced |
|
|
¼
cup |
|
yellow raisins |
|
|
1
Tbs |
|
butter |
|
|
2
small |
|
sliced yellow onions |
|
|
1
tsp |
|
chopped fresh thyme |
|
|
¼
tsp |
|
pepper |
|
|
½
cup |
|
chicken broth |
|
|
2
Tbs |
|
maple syrup |
|
|
1
Tbs |
|
flour |
|
|
|
|
|
|
1 |
Heat oven to
400 degrees. |
|
2 |
Brown chops
in large, non-stick skillet over medium-high
heat for 8-10 minutes (turning once). Remove and
place in 13x9" dish. Spread apple pieces and
raisins over the top and along the sides. |
|
3 |
Add butter,
onions, thyme, and pepper to the skillet and
cook until onions are browned and tender (about
15 minutes); transfer to baking dish. Combine
chicken broth, syrup and flour. Add to baking
dish. |
|
4 |
Bake 30
minutes, until sauce is bubbling. |
|
|
|
|
Servings: 4 |
|
|
|
Cooking Tips |
|
*It's ok to leave
the apple peel on. The red adds nice color to the dish.
Try it both ways. |
